Innovative Audiology Services

Nowadays' world, hearing loss is a common problem. Thankfully, innovative audiology services are offering promising solutions to help individuals restore their hearing. From conventional hearing aids to the latest developments, audiologists are committed to providing personalized care and solutions that meet the unique needs of each patient.

These of these innovative audiology services include:

* Inner ear devices: These systems can provide a new sense of auditory perception for individuals with severe to profound hearing loss.

* Bone conduction hearing aids|: This type of device transmits sound vibrations through the bone, bypassing the outer and middle ear. It can be a beneficial option for people with outer ear hearing loss.

* :Smart hearing devices : These solutions offer greater sound quality, noise reduction, and customizability. They can be configured to meet a wide range of hearing loss needs.

* Hearing assistive technology|: These devices can help amplify sound in specific situations, such as during phone conversations or in noisy environments. They can be especially beneficial for people with mild to moderate hearing loss.

Effective Ear Infection Treatment to Soothe Symptoms

Dealing with an ear infection can be painful and uncomfortable. Luckily, there are tried-and-true treatments available to help you find relief and feel better faster. First, it's important to talk to your doctor for a proper diagnosis and treatment plan. They may recommend prescription pain relievers like ibuprofen or acetaminophen to alleviate discomfort. Warm compresses placed on the affected ear can also provide soothing relief by reducing muscle tension. For some cases, your doctor may prescribe ear drops to fight the infection directly. It's important to follow your doctor's instructions carefully and complete the full course of treatment even if you start feeling better sooner.

In addition to medical treatments, there are some home remedies that may help alleviate symptoms. Staying hydrated is crucial as it can help thin the mucus buildup in your ears. Softly blowing your nose can also help drain any fluid and reduce pressure. Getting plenty of rest is important for your body to overcome the infection. Avoid swimming or getting water in your ears until the infection has cleared up.
